
Choosing the right workout environment can significantly impact your fitness results, motivation and overall well being. While both indoor and outdoor workouts have their unique advantages understanding their pros and cons can help you design a routine that best fits your goals.
Benefits of Indoor Workouts
Indoor workouts offer a controlled environment which means you can exercise regardless of weather conditions. Whether it’s scorching heat, heavy rain or freezing temperatures, gyms and home setups allow consistency in your routine. Modern gyms provide access to advanced equipment, from strength machines to cardio gear, enabling structured and targeted training for muscle building, fat loss or endurance improvement.
Indoor workouts also ensure safety and comfort. You avoid risks associated with uneven terrain, traffic or polluted outdoor air. Additionally the ability to follow guided classes or online workouts can enhance motivation and improve form making it ideal for beginners and experienced fitness enthusiasts.
Advantages of Outdoor Workouts
Outdoor workouts on the other hand connect you with nature. Exercising in fresh air with natural sunlight not only boosts vitamin D levels but also enhances mood and reduces stress. Outdoor routines encourage versatile and functional training. Running on trails, cycling on uneven paths or body weight exercises in a park engage multiple muscle groups and improve balance and coordination.
The psychological benefits of outdoor workouts are notable. Exposure to sunlight and greenery stimulates endorphin production, reducing anxiety and enhancing mental clarity. Activities like hiking, swimming or sports provide variety and make fitness feel more like recreation than a routine.
Drawbacks to Consider
Indoor workouts can sometimes feel monotonous and limit your exposure to natural surroundings. Equipment dependency can also restrict creativity in training. Conversely outdoor workouts come with environmental challenges such as bad weather, pollution or safety hazards. Uneven surfaces increase the risk of injury and extreme conditions may disrupt your consistency.
Making the Right Choice
The best approach may be a blend of both indoor and outdoor workouts. For strength training, HIIT or structured routine indoor workouts offer convenience and focus. For cardio, flexibility and mental rejuvenation outdoor workouts are unmatched. By combining the two you can enjoy consistent results while keeping your fitness routine engaging and holistic.
In the end the choice boils down to your goals, preferences and lifestyle both indoor and outdoor workouts can help you stay fit, healthy and motivated.
